Buying Guide: How To Choose A Ceramic Disc Heater
When Selecting A Ceramic Disc Or PTC Ceramic Heater, Consider The Following Technical And Practical Factors To Match The Unit To Your Space And Safety Needs.
Heating Technology And Efficiency
- Ceramic Disc vs PTC Ceramic: Both Use ceramic heating elements, but PTC (positive temperature coefficient) ceramic typically self‑regulates to reduce current as it warms, improving safety and efficiency.
- Wattage And Coverage: 1500W Models Offer Faster Heat And Broader Coverage For Small To Medium Rooms. Lower‑watt Models Are Suitable For Desks And Tiny Spaces.
- Heat Distribution: Oscillating Models Or Those With Designed Funnels/airflow Patterns Spread Heat More Evenly.
Controls And Temperature Management
- Thermostat Precision: Digital controls With 1°F Increments Allow Fine Tuning; Mechanical Dials Provide Simpler Operation.
- Modes & Timer: Fan‑only, low/high heat, timers, and programmable settings Improve Comfort And Energy Use.
- Remote & Display: Remote control And Clear Digital Displays Are Helpful For Bedrooms Or Hard‑to‑reach Installations.
Safety Features
- Tip‑Over Protection: Essential For Floor Heaters; Automatically Shuts Off If Knocked Over.
- Overheat Shutoff: Prevents Component Damage And Reduces Fire Risk.
- Certified Materials: Look For ETL, UL, Or Equivalent Certification And Flame‑retardant Housings.
Portability, Size, And Placement
- Form Factor: Compact Units Are Best For Desks; Taller Or Oscillating Units Fit Living Rooms Better.
- Weight & Handles: Built‑in Handles And Lightweight Designs Improve Mobility.
- Placement Considerations: Keep Clearances From Curtains, Furniture, And Moisture Sources; Use ALCI/ground‑fault‑protected Outlets For Bathroom Use.
Noise, Durability, And Build Quality
- Fan Noise: Consider Quieter Models For Bedrooms; fan‑only modes can increase noise.
- Materials: Metal Grilles And Sturdier Housings Typically Last Longer Than Thin Plastics.
- Brand Support: Manufacturer Warranties And Documented Certifications Add Confidence.
Energy Use And Cost Efficiency
- Targeted Heating: Ceramic Heaters Are Efficient For Localized Heating Versus Whole‑house Systems.
- Adjustable Output: Models With Low/High Settings Or Thermostat Cycling Can Lower Energy Consumption.
- Room Insulation: Effective insulation And draft reduction Reduce Runtime And Improve Efficiency.
